What are the popular events and traditions at The Catholic University of America?

The Catholic University of America hosts several notable events that contribute to campus life and foster community spirit among students. One key tradition is Capital Fest, an event that brings together students for a vibrant celebration featuring music, activities, and social engagement. Another popular event is Cardinalpalooza, which serves as a welcome celebration typically designed to help new students acclimate and bond with the campus community through entertainment and various activities. Additionally, Mr. CUA is a tradition that showcases student involvement and campus pride through a competitive and spirited event highlighting individuals representing the university.
